Make friends with silence — Sit with stillness and listen to what emerges.
Do a daily check-in — Notice when you feel alive vs. drained.
Create something small — Movement follows action, not the other way around.
Change your inputs — Seek new voices, places, and ideas.
Reconnect with your body — Move, stretch, dance, breathe.
Let curiosity replace control — Ask “I wonder what’s trying to happen here?”
See stagnation as compost — The decay of old rhythms feeds new growth.
Stagnation isn’t the end of your story—it’s an invitation to evolve. When the things that once brought meaning stop working, that silence is often where the next version of you begins to take shape.
